Nashville (BNA) to Osceola (OEO)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Nashville International Airport (BNA) in Nashville, United States to L O Simenstad Municipal Airport (OEO) in Osceola, United States is 1,140 kilometers (708 miles / 615 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 2h, flying north northwest at a heading of 336°.

This is a short-haul route typically served by narrow-body aircraft such as the Boeing 737 or Airbus A320 family. In-flight service is usually limited to drinks and light snacks.

This is a domestic route within United States. Both airports operate in the same country, which may simplify travel requirements and documentation.

Time zone information: When it's 11:18 in Nashville, it's 11:18 in Osceola.

The return flight from Osceola (OEO) to Nashville (BNA) follows a heading of 152° (south southeast).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
